s390/cpumf: cpum_cf PMU displays invalid value after hotplug remove
commit 9d48c7af upstream. When a CPU is hotplugged while the perf stat -e cycles command is running, a wrong (very large) value is displayed immediately after the CPU removal: Check the values, shouldn't be too high as in time counts unit events 1.001101919 29261846 cycles 2.002454499 17523405 cycles 3.003659292 24361161 cycles 4.004816983 18446744073638406144 cycles 5.005671647 <not counted> cycles ... The CPU hotplug off took place after 3 seconds. The issue is the read of the event count value after 4 seconds when the CPU is not available and the read of the counter returns an error. This is treated as a counter value of zero. This results in a very large value (0 - previous_value). Fix this by detecting the hotplugged off CPU and report 0 instead of a very large number.
